We break down exactly why the "liquid glass" interface had everyone comparing Apple to Microsoft's biggest UI disaster from 2006. Spoiler: the internet wasn't kind.

We’re also surprised at how popular Ireland’s favourite AI actually is, how Elon Musk’s billion dollar tantrum worked, and reveal to must-watch movies about tech billionaires. 

Plus we speak with three company founders about their experience testing the tech  boundaries of sustainability. It’s part of BnM’s Accelerate Green Grow Programme which you can discover at accelerategreen.ie

The founders are Neil Skeffington from NovelPlast; Andrew Billingsley from PlasWire, and Ruairi Dooley from BiaSol.
